Compose UI
介绍
Compose UI 是 Android Jetpack 中的一个现代 UI 工具包,它采用声明式编程模型来构建用户界面。与传统的 XML 布局方式不同,Compose 允许开发者使用 Kotlin 代码来定义 UI,从而简化了 UI 开发流程,并提高了代码的可读性和可维护性。
Compose 的核心思想是声明式 UI,即通过描述 UI 应该是什么样子,而不是如何一步步构建它。这种方式使得 UI 开发更加直观和高效。
为什么选择 Compose?
- 声明式编程:通过描述 UI 的状态,而不是手动管理 UI 的变化。
- 简化代码:减少样板代码,提高开发效率。
- 实时预览:支持实时预览 UI 变化,加快开发速度。
- 强大的工具支持:与 Android Studio 深度集成,提供丰富的开发工具。